This book presents contributions from the joint event 8th INGEO International Conference on Engineering Surveying and 4th SIG Symposium on Engineering Geodesy, which was planned to be held in Dubrovnik, Croatia, on April 14, 2020 and was canceled due to COVID-19 pandemic situation. http://ingeo-sig2020.hgd1952.hr/index.php/2020/08/31/ingeosig2020-virtual-conference-october-22-23-2020/. The event brought together professionals in the fields of civil engineering and engineering surveying to discuss new technologies, their applicability, and operability.



Combines contributions on engineering surveying and the application of new technologies Presents up-to-date contributions on various topics concerning geodesy and civil engineering Includes papers on cultural heritage documentation
